    Abstract: "Overview RESTful Web APIs with Spring LiveLessons demonstrates how to write REST services, and manage, secure and consume them using Spring Boot. Description REST has enabled people to build mobile applications that capture our imagination, entertain us, and help us. REST has ushered in a generation of incredibly sophisticated, HTML5-powered browser applications. REST has also made it easier for organizations to adopt a service-oriented architecture with less friction. REST's flexibility, however, can also be its greatest weakness: as often as not there is no clear guidance on where to go and how to get there. What does it mean to deploy a REST service? How do you handle errors in a REST service? What's the easiest way to write a REST service? Spring Developer Advocate Josh Long discusses and demonstrates strategies for securing REST API access along with handling errors and versioning. These LiveLessons also cover how hypermedia and HATEOAS help you to deliver developer and consume friendly web services."--Resource description page.

    Abstract: "AngularJS is a powerful JavaScript framework, maintained by Google, for building web applications (called SPAs, or Single Page apps) and for enhancing various parts of your web pages. It's a comprehensive framework that makes both development and testing easier by extending web applications with MVC or model-view-controller capability. Marc Wandschneider, Senior Developer Advocate at Google, has more than 20 years of experience as a developer and is the author of two programming books and two other LiveLessons video training. In this video training, Marc uses a live-coding approach throughout to show developers how to start from scratch and work their way up to building a meaningful, yet not overly complicated application."--Resource description page.

    Abstract: "How well do you know C#? Put your knowledge to the test in Bill Wagner's C# Puzzlers video LiveLesson! Bill Wagner's C# Puzzlers exposes common misconceptions that developers have about the C# language. Misconceptions occur when developers are unclear about how language features interact. On other occasions, a lack of understanding about how a single features works, can stump and frustrate the most experienced developer. Using the "Puzzler" format, Bill demonstrates these misconceptions using small code samples; he then explores different ways for you to modify the code until its behavior is correct. This collection of Puzzlers is divided into seven sections. Each section delves into the rules that govern aspects of the C# language that developers find most confusing: I.Generics II. Method Resolution III. Named and Optional Parameters IV. LINQ V. Value and Reference Semantics VI. Dynamic Programming in C#"--Resource description page.
